This role is primarily responsible for performing telephonic consultations with members to complete comprehensive medication reviews, adherence related consults, and improve disease state management. In addition, the clinical pharmacist will document the care delivered and communicates essential information to the member's primary care providers.

Qualifications & Requirements:
  • Bachelor's Degree in Pharmacy or PharmD
  • Current and unrestricted Pharmacist license in the state of residence
  • Strong knowledge of disease state management guidelines and the 5 Core Elements of MTM Services (1) Medication Therapy Review - Comprehensive and Targeted, 2) Personal Medication List (PML), 3) Medication-Related Action Plan (MAP), 4) Interventions and Referrals, and 5) Documentation of Services and Follow-up)
